Gold Coast Council announces grants to promote live music

Gold Coast Council announces grants to promote live music
January 5, 2021

The City of Gold Coast has announced a business improvement grants program to help live music venues and businesses grow and diversify their operations.

Advising that the Council sees live music as being of value to the area’s “cultural economy”, Gold Coast Deputy Mayor, Donna Gates stated “that’s why we endorsed the Music Action Plan in 2019 which encourages the development of live music right across the Gold Coast.

“Part of that plan includes a business improvement package to further stimulate the industry.

“As we all know, visitors and locals experiencing live music in a variety of coast venues has been a mainstay of our cultural identity for decades.

“We are delighted to be again encouraging live music and music business owners through this funding program.’’

The Grants are available to assist businesses purchase equipment, improve business operations or acoustics, the program is offering a total of $80,000 in $5,000 and $10,000 grants for existing music venues and businesses.

Application close on 27th January 2021 and businesses can apply if they are an existing live music venue (or business) that has music development/creation/promotion/management as its core purpose.
